How to deal with the Tomcat port number being occupied
When trying to start the Tomcat server, if it cannot bind to Its default port (8080), you may receive an error that the port number is occupied. There are several ways to solve this problem:
1. Determine the process occupying the port
- Use the
netstat -ano
command on Windows View the ports in use. - Use the
sudo lsof -i tcp:8080
command to view the ports in use on Linux/Mac.
2. End the occupying process
- If the process that is occupying the port is no longer needed, please end it.
- On Windows, use Task Manager to end the process.
- On Linux/Mac, use the
kill -9 <pid>
command to end the process, where<pid>
is the process ID of the process that owns the port.
3. Change the Tomcat port
- Change the Tomcat port number in the
conf/server.xml
file. - Find the
<Connector>
element and modify theport
attribute, for example:<Connector port="8081"
. - Restart the Tomcat server.
4. Disable other applications
- If you have multiple web applications or services running on the same server, check if There are other applications using port 8080.
- Disable or uninstall these applications and try restarting Tomcat.
5. Adjust the firewall settings
- Check whether the firewall blocks Tomcat from accessing port 8080.
- Allow inbound connections on the firewall to port 8080.
